    The cost of a hair transplant in Ottawa can vary significantly based on several factors, including the extent of hair loss, the technique used, and the clinic's reputation. Generally, hair transplant procedures are priced on a per-graft basis, with each graft containing one to four hair follicles. In Ottawa, the average cost per graft can range from $5 to $10. For a typical hair transplant, which might involve 1,000 to 3,000 grafts, the total cost could be between $5,000 and $30,000.

    Factors influencing the cost include: 1. Technique: Follicular Unit Extraction (FUE) is often more expensive than Follicular Unit Transplantation (FUT) due to its minimally invasive nature and quicker recovery time. 2. Surgeon's Expertise: Highly experienced surgeons may charge more for their services. 3. Clinic's Location and Reputation: Premium clinics in upscale areas may have higher fees. 4. Additional Costs: These can include pre-operative tests, post-operative medications, and follow-up consultations.

    It's crucial to consider the quality of the procedure and the long-term results over the initial cost. Consulting with multiple clinics and understanding the full scope of the procedure and associated costs can help in making an informed decision.

    Understanding the Cost of Hair Transplant in Ottawa

    When considering a hair transplant in Ottawa, it's crucial to understand that the cost can vary significantly based on several factors. As a medical professional in the field of hair restoration, I often get asked about the pricing structure, and I aim to provide a clear and comprehensive overview to help potential patients make informed decisions.

    Factors Influencing Hair Transplant Costs

    Several elements contribute to the overall cost of a hair transplant procedure. These include:

    1. Type of Procedure: The two main types of hair transplant procedures are Follicular Unit Transplantation (FUT) and Follicular Unit Extraction (FUE). FUE tends to be more expensive due to its minimally invasive nature and the time-consuming process of extracting individual follicles.

    2. Number of Grafts: The cost is often calculated per graft. The more grafts required, the higher the cost. Typically, the range per graft can vary, but it's essential to ensure that the clinic provides a transparent pricing structure.

    3. Surgeon's Expertise: The experience and reputation of the surgeon play a significant role in the cost. Highly skilled surgeons with a proven track record may charge more, but their expertise can ensure better results and fewer complications.

    4. Facility and Equipment: The quality of the facility and the technology used can also affect the cost. State-of-the-art equipment and a comfortable, hygienic environment can contribute to higher costs but also provide a safer and more effective procedure.

    Average Cost in Ottawa

    In Ottawa, the average cost for a hair transplant can range from CAD 4 to CAD 8 per graft. For a typical procedure requiring 2,000 grafts, this would translate to a total cost between CAD 8,000 and CAD 16,000. However, it's important to note that these are general estimates and actual costs can vary.

    Additional Costs to Consider

    Beyond the initial procedure cost, patients should also consider:

    • Consultation Fees: Some clinics may charge for the initial consultation, which is an essential step to assess the patient's condition and discuss the best treatment options.
    • Post-Operative Care: Costs for medications, follow-up appointments, and any necessary touch-up procedures should be factored in.
    • Travel and Accommodation: For out-of-town patients, travel and accommodation expenses can add to the overall cost.
